It happens all the time. Everything from harsh weather, high winds aging shingles, or even improper installation can cause shingles to come loose and blow into the wind. If you notice your shingles are loose or fallen into your yard, take action right away. The longer you wait to repair it, the more damage can occur.
What Are Shingles?
Shingles protect the surface of your roof, especially from water. Notice how they overlap? This is for a very important reason. This attractive pattern creates a barrier that keeps water from seeping onto the roof. When even one or two shingles are missing or loose, gaps form and allow water to get in, causing surface damage. This causing a domino effect and could effect your ceiling, walls, floors another other areas inside your home. The good news is that this is preventable if you take action right away.
Take a look at what you can do is you are missing shingles.
1. First Inspect Your Roof: Get up on the roof and look around for areas where shingles are missing or damaged.
2. Cover and secure the area with a waterproof tarp: This will protect your roof from additional damage.
3. Replace missing shingles: Consult a professional roofing contractor to properly repair any damage and replace missing shingles.
4. Check for additional damage. There may be additional areas on the roof that need repaired.
